Job Title: Sacristan
Location: Basilica of St. Louis (Old Cathedral)

Position Summary
The Sacristan plays a vital role in supporting the liturgical life of the Basilica of St. Louis. This position is responsible for preparing the worship space for Mass and other liturgical celebrations ensuring that all sacred vessels vestments and materials are properly arranged and cared for. The Sacristan works closely with the priests and the lead sacristan offering dependable assistance before during and after liturgical services.

Key Responsibilities

  • Prepare the sanctuary and sacristy for daily and weekend Masses weddings funerals and other liturgical events.
  • Set out vestments vessels books and other items required for the celebration of the liturgy.
  • Assist the priests and lead sacristan with any needs related to liturgical preparation or cleanup.
  • Maintain reverence and professionalism while working in sacred spaces.
  • Ensure all liturgical items are cleaned stored and handled with proper care.
  • Monitor inventory of liturgical supplies and communicate needs as appropriate.
  • Support the smooth flow of liturgical celebrations by being attentive organized and responsive.
